Transaction 8bc54021bc3ca276819d35cb5f25685e1a5d166a183d9d5c122e9210a191cd3a
1 Input
2 Outputs
- 8bc54021bc3ca276819d35cb5f25685e1a5d166a183d9d5c122e9210a191cd3a:0
- 8bc54021bc3ca276819d35cb5f25685e1a5d166a183d9d5c122e9210a191cd3a:1
value 10000000
address 3HTHzHMApgf3qaUFtUSwawZDJppvvQ9Ayq
value 777451
address 1ELGi8TJbKEDTtfSHP3hgycHZbCUAgvzB5